Part VIIIToday, the Republic of Belarus is experiencing difficult times related to tackling the tasks of economic recovery from the consequences of the global crisis caused by the coronavirus pandemic. Responding to the urgent challenges and threats, the country is seeking reserves to put all economic entities on the trajectory of sustainable growth. Special attention in this regard is paid to the issues of support and development of exports, which is one of the main priorities of the Belarusian economy. After all, in its structure it traditionally accounts for more than half of the gross domestic product, which makes it one of the main sources of sustainable economic growth in the country. In the post-crisis period of development of world trade, Belarus has adopted a policy of increasing the share of science-intensive and high-tech products in its export structure and diversifying supplies to new markets. The proposed study discusses how this task can be achieved by relying on a multi-vector foreign economic policy.
